Output efb76f6cfea06c1cd45a15a2fc195b596fd234d77268fe485a961f0c87655810:0

value
1390000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ebf70576b16bba272963ae05842bfe5449bfedc OP_EQUAL
address
3PTQ5buwncuBpd8ZHDbAuJcdCTNAnnnvRz
transaction
efb76f6cfea06c1cd45a15a2fc195b596fd234d77268fe485a961f0c87655810
spent
true